Understanding the Role of Accident Attorneys
Accident attorneys specialize in personal injury law, representing individuals who have been injured in accidents caused by someone else’s negligence. Their primary goal is to help clients obtain compensation for their losses, including medical expenses, lost wages, pain, and suffering. They provide a range of services:2
- Case Evaluation: Assessing the merits of a potential claim and advising clients on their legal options.
- Investigation: Gathering evidence, reviewing police reports, and consulting with experts to determine the cause of the accident and identify liable parties3.
- Negotiation: Communicating with insurance companies to negotiate a fair settlement that covers the client’s damages3.
- Litigation: Filing a lawsuit and representing the client in court if a settlement cannot be reached2.
Types of Accident Cases Handled in Brazoria County
Accident attorneys in Brazoria County handle a wide array of cases, each with its own unique set of challenges and legal considerations:
- Car Accidents: Car accidents are a common type of personal injury case, often resulting in significant injuries and property damage. These cases can involve issues such as distracted driving, speeding, and drunk driving13.
- Truck Accidents: Due to the size and weight of commercial trucks, accidents involving these vehicles often result in severe injuries or fatalities. Truck accident cases can be complex, involving multiple parties and intricate regulations4.
- Motorcycle Accidents: Motorcycle riders are particularly vulnerable to serious injuries in accidents. These cases often involve issues of visibility and negligence on the part of other drivers1.
- Industrial Accidents: Brazoria County’s industrial sector means workplace accidents are, unfortunately, a reality. These can stem from negligence, equipment malfunction, or lack of safety protocols25.
- Wrongful Death: In the most tragic cases, accidents can result in the death of a loved one. Accident attorneys can assist families in pursuing wrongful death claims to recover compensation for their losses2.

Steps to Take After an Accident
If you’ve been involved in an accident, taking the right steps can protect your health and legal rights:
- Seek Medical Attention: Prioritize your health and seek immediate medical attention for any injuries.
- Document the Scene: If possible, document the accident scene by taking photos and gathering information from witnesses.
- Report the Accident: Report the accident to the appropriate authorities, such as the police.
- Consult an Attorney: Contact an experienced accident attorney to discuss your case and understand your legal options.
- Avoid Discussing the Accident: Refrain from discussing the accident with anyone other than your attorney or law enforcement.
